We invite you to join us as we strive to be The Most Trusted Partner for Health. ​​ The Manager of Hospital Regulatory and Accreditation is responsible for assisting in maintaining a state of regulatory compliance across the INTEGRIS Health Hospital Enterprise by overseeing accreditation readiness activities, monitoring adherence to applicable standards, coordinating survey preparedness efforts, and supporting continuous improvement initiatives. This role servs as a subject matter expert on accreditation and regulatory standards to ensure that hospitals within the system meet or exceed requirements set forth by accrediting bodies and regulatory agencies, thereby promoting patient safety, quality of care, and organizational excellence.
